Effect of sleep on hypoxic stimulation of breathing at sea level and altitude

Donal J. Reed 1 and Ralph H. Kellogg 1

1 Department of Physiology, University of California, Berkeley and San Francisco; and White Mountain Research Station, Big Pine, California

The effect of sleep on the level of hypoxia in four adult male, sea-level residents was studied at sea level, during 23 days at 14,250 ft. and after return to sea level. The subjects, awake and asleep, breathed graded O2-N2 mixtures, each followed by a high O2 gas. Sleep did not significantly affect the hypoxic drive of breathing as evaluated from the steady-state levels of ventilation or from the immediate respiratory depression produced by interrupting hypoxia. At the ambient altitude O2 tension, arterial O2 saturation indicated by ear oximeter fell 4–8% with sleep. This fall in arterial oxygenation is believed to be sufficient to help explain the increased severity of mountain sickness which is commonly associated with sleep at altitude.
